Justin Bieber recently put all his cards on the table during a raw and wide-ranging interview with Apple Music's Zane Lowe.
During the 45-minute conversation, the 25-year-old pop superstar opened up about everything from his past self-destructive behavior to his blossoming new life with wife Hailey Baldwin.

Maasa Ishihara is a Japanese dancer who has supported performances by numerous A-list Western acts including Justin Bieber, Nicki Minaj, TLC, Ciara, Major Lazer and Becky G, as well as J-pop megastars Namie Amuro, SMAP and more. Her most recent engagement was performing with Ariana Grande at the Grammys in January, and she is currently rehearsing as one of the main dancers in Bieber's upcoming tour.
